Let me admit first of all that I am no expert on cpq.

But is it just me or is this one screwed up, confused management? I'll definitely go along with Dell being overvalued and accounting scams, and slick manipulation of analysts and the investor community. But as a company, they have a plan that I can understand. Minimize inventory both for roi purposes, and for not being the one holding the stuff when it goes obsolete.

CPQ on the other hand, has an old fashioned channel model, now wants to have a direct model too, but meanwhile buys tandem computer to grab a bigger piece of the enterprise market, and digital. Digital, imo, was another unfocused mess of a company. IBM, only with less controls. So now we have CPQ being like a jack of all trades, but master of none.

Do you agree with this portrait?
